Mid/Senior Full Stack Dev (Ruby, React)

  • Full-time

Company Description

We help locals and tourists get access to the best hotels' amenities without needing to book a room. After just one year we are the leading platform to book daycation in Spain with more than 150 hotels and are already expanding to Portugal, France and Italy.

After a year, we've raised a first round of financing with Reus Capital Partners (investor en Badi y 21 buttons) and some business angels. With it we structured our sales team and hired our first full-stack dev to maintain, improve the platform and launch new features.

Our platform aims to be the marketplace where locals and tourists can find the best daycation experiences in Europe and elsewhere to enjoy the pools, restaurants, spas and more. We're focused on growing fast while maintaining a stable and fast platform.

Technological stack:

  • Ruby on Rails
  • Javascript
  • PostgreSQL
  • Heroku
  • AWS

Job Description

  • Lead our tech growth and team
  • Improve, test and maintain existing features
  • Develop, test and launch new features 
  • Work closely with other devs, business and marketing team to prioritize and plan new features
  • Worked on all three layers of the MVC
  • Implement a TDD approach to ensure quality
  • Investigate slow performance and optimizing queries to ensure speed
  • Prepare for the implementation of React by further advancing into a component first approach
  • Improve infrastructure architecture to support growth

Qualifications

  • You have 3+ years experience building scalable systems and applications using Ruby and it's framework Ruby on Rails
  • You are experienced with at least one component-based frontend framework like React
  • You are experienced with PostgreSQL 
  • You know how to test software on different levels: unit, integration and E2E
  • You are able to analyse metrics about system health and performance
  • You understand lean and agile practices
  • You have effective communication and interpersonal skills
  • You can professionally communicate in written and spoken English
  • Ideally an understanding of website optimisation and SEO principles
  • You love an open, inclusive culture that supports learning and encourages collaboration 
  • You like to cooperate with product and business stakeholders building together a trust working environment
  • You have experience managing a team

Additional Information

  • Full-time (40h) permanent contract
  • 26 days of holiday
  • Flexible hours
  • Between 45.000 y 60.000€ before taxes yearly according to profile
  • Evolution within the company
  • Remote (but Spain resident)